Contrary to what one might have feared, road traffic remained fluid this Tuesday, January 30 around the airport. Few corks


We could expect significant slowdowns with the blocking of many highways by farmers, but road traffic remained relatively fluid in Île-de-France this Tuesday morning.

With only around a hundred kilometers of traffic jams in the Paris region a little before 7:30 a.m., according to the Sytadin website, we are even in a rather low range.

This was particularly the case in Val-d'Oise, near Roissy-Charles-de-Gaulle airport.

Despite the blocking of the A1 motorway a few kilometers away, at the Chennevières area, where farmers took up residence on Monday for an indefinite period, the secondary roads did not experience any particular increase in traffic.

The surrounding towns and villages were also spared.
